Just Like Callaghan by Cosmo Gordon-Lennox
Promotional postcard for Just Like Callaghan by Cosmo Gordon-Lennox from Le Coup de Fouet by M. Hennequin and G. Duval (1901). First produced at the Criterion Theatre, 3rd June 1903. The title comes from the husband making his wife believe that he has a double who carries out his extra-marital intrigues. Callaghan, the imaginary double, an Irishman in the adaptation, was from Marseilles in the French original. Date: circa 1903
